The soil in the Everglades is rich in organic material because of the slow decomposition of plant matter due to the waterlogged conditions in the marshland. The slow decomposition process allows organic material to accumulate, leading to the formation of nutrient-rich peat soil.

Glucose is an example of an energy-rich compound as it can be broken down in cells through cellular respiration to produce a large amount of ATP, which serves as the main energy currency of the cell.
This type of cell is likely a mitochondrion, which is known as the "powerhouse" of the cell. Mitochondria convert nutrients into energy-rich molecules called ATP through a process called cellular respiration. This energy is essential for the cell to carry out its functions and maintain life.
